Comprehending Car Key Types
Before delving into the costs related to reprogramming a car key, it's important to understand the kinds of car keys presently offered on the marketplace. Each type has its special reprogramming requirements and associated costs.
Kinds Of Car KeysConventional Key: The traditional key that operates the ignition and door locks without any electronic elements.Transponder Key: Contains an embedded chip that communicates with the vehicle's ignition system. If the key is not programmed correctly, the engine will not start.Key Fob: A push-button control that likewise includes keyless entry abilities, and in some cases, starts the vehicle without placing the key.Smart Key: Offers advanced functions such as push-button start and proximity sensing units. They are normally discovered in high-end or newer automobiles.Key TypeDescriptionProgramming ComplexityGeneral Cost RangeStandard KeyFundamental key for ignition and locks.Low₤ 5 - ₤ 15Transponder KeyElectronic chip for anti-theft system.Moderate₤ 70 - ₤ 150Key FobPush-button control with keyless entry capabilities.High₤ 100 - ₤ 200Smart KeyAdvanced features, push-button start.Extremely High₤ 200 - ₤ 400Factors Influencing Reprogramming Costs
The cost to reprogram a car key can vary due to numerous factors:
Type of Key: As shown in the table above, various key types have varying levels of complexity and costs.Vehicle Make and Model: Luxury or more recent vehicles frequently require specific devices or software application to reprogram the keys, which can drive up expenses.Company: Costs can differ considerably between dealerships, automotive locksmith professionals, and independent service technicians. Car dealerships often charge greater costs for their specialized services.Location: Geographical location can play a function-- services in urban areas may cost more compared to those in backwoods due to require and overhead costs.Extra Features: Advanced features like remote start or extra smart functionalities might need extra programming, increasing the total cost.Emergency Services: If a service is needed outside of typical company hours, expenses may rise due to emergency service costs.Cost Breakdown
Here is a more detailed breakdown of possible expenses:
ServiceEstimated CostReplacement of conventional key₤ 5 - ₤ 15Replacement of transponder key₤ 70 - ₤ 150Key fob replacement and programming₤ 100 - ₤ 200Smart key programming₤ 200 - ₤ 400Emergency key programming service₤ 150 - ₤ 300How to Reprogram a Car Key

For how long does it take to reprogram a car key?
The procedure can take anywhere from 10 minutes to an hour depending upon the intricacy of the key and the vehicle's make and design.
2. Can I reprogram a car key myself?
Some conventional keys can be self-programmed, however most electronic keys need specialized equipment and technical proficiency.
3. What occurs if I lose my car key?
If you lose your only key, a brand-new key will need to be created and programmed-- this can be quite expensive if it's a transponder or clever key.
4. Is it cheaper to reprogram a key than to get a new one?
Reprogramming is generally less costly than creating and programming a completely new key, however this depends on the type and condition of the key in concern.
5. Are there any DIY sets for reprogramming a car key?
Some kits are offered, but they are usually only efficient for particular makes and models. It's advisable to speak with the vehicle's handbook and inspect compatibility.
